mà chược
Definition
- Noun:
- Mahjong: A traditional tile-based game of Chinese origin, typically played by four players seated around a square table. The game uses a set of 144 rectangular tiles, traditionally made from bone, ivory, or bamboo, but now commonly made from plastic or other materials. The objective involves drawing and discarding tiles to form specific combinations or sets.

Advanced Usage
- The game is often associated with social gatherings, family events, and gambling in some contexts.
- "đánh mà chược": to play mahjong.
- Các cụ già ngồi đánh mà chược suốt buổi chiều. (The elderly sat and played mahjong all afternoon.)
Variants and Related Words
- Mạt chược (n): An alternative spelling and pronunciation for "mà chược," also meaning mahjong.
- "Mạt chược" là cách phiên âm khác của "mà chược". ("Mạt chược" is another transliteration for "mà chược".)
